Title :
Negative group delay circuit fabricated in an integrated circuit chip
Author :
Kayano, Yoshiki ; Yanagisawa, Ryosuke ; Inoue, H.
Author_Institution :
Dept. of Electr. & Electron. Eng., Akita Univ., Akita, Japan
Abstract :
Basic left-handed transmission line (LH-TL) characteristics made on PCB is an important future issue for the application of the EMC field. In this paper, possibility of transmission line with negative group delay characteristic in an integrated circuit is investigated experimentally and numerically. The measured and simulated results demonstrated the usability of the LH-TL. The experimental results indicate some negative group delay characteristic but the differences with the calculation is still existed at higher frequencies.
